Thom Yorke and Mark Pritchard’s Tall Tales’ is loaded with existential jitters and alienation

- Helen Brown

TRACKS IN 2020 VISION

“Everybody, run, it looks like rain,” drawls Thom Yorke over the mechanised beat and lurid, tuba-aping synths of “Back in the Game”. The first single from the progtronic Tall Tales – the Radiohead frontman’s first full-length electronic collaboration with Yeovil-born producer/musician Mark Pritchard – offers disquieting fanfare for a dense, dystopian album. A record full of existential jitters, it addresses themes of human greed, mendacity, disconnection and the climate crisis. Vintage keyboard effects slip, slide and splash in looping melodies, like chunks of ice caps tumbling into the sea, while Yorke’s angsty vocal drifts at a sorrowful altitude.
